What You’ll Do for Us
+ Serve as Pilot-In-Command and manage all flight crew activities to ensure each trip is flown safely and effectively. Maintain a pleasant operational environment providing positive interaction with the crew, passengers, and support personnel.
+ Evaluate all risk factors and contingencies (i.e. weather) and adjust trip as necessary to maintain the highest degree of safety possible.
+ Select and implement the most efficient and comfortable routes and altitudes within the structure of international (or domestic) airspace.
+ Comply with government laws and regulations, and Company-specific policies, procedures, and standards. Keep up to date with new procedures, policies, requirements, FAA, and ICAO regulations.
+ Diligently perform all post flight duties, including administrative requirements and communicating pertinent problems to maintenance personnel.

FAA Requirements
+ Unrestricted FAA Airline Transport Pilot (ATP) certificate with airplane multiengine class rating
+ Current FAA first-class medical certificate
+ FCC Restricted Radiotelephone Operator Permit (RR)
Required Qualifications
+ 3+ years of domestic and international aviation experience (civil, military, or government)
+ Current passport or other travel documents enabling the bearer to freely exit and re-enter the U.S. (multiple reentry status) and be legally eligible to work in the U.S. (possess proper working documents).
+ Must be able to travel freely without restriction to all countries TCCC serves
+ Service to Passengers:
+ Ability to provide direct support to strategic leadership of the company by taking charge of all planning, coordination, and execution requirements of worldwide air travel. This includes responding to the dynamic changes occurring on every trip.
+ Minimum of 3,000 hours of total documented flight time.
+ Minimum of 1,500 hours of fixed wing turbine time (airplane and powered lift combined).
+ When evaluating the flight time of applicants meeting the basic qualifications, consideration will be given to, among other things, quality, quantity, recency, and verifiability of training; complexity of aircraft flown; types of flight operations; and hours flown as PIC in turbine powered aircraft.
